September 22, 2016 Dispatches

Fragile Progress in Global Fight Against Child Marriage

While Percentage of Girls Marrying Drops, Overall Numbers Climb Higher

Lalita B., 17, had an arranged marriage at the age of 12 with a 37-year-old man. She became pregnant soon after marriage, and two of her newborns died. Lalita’s third child survived. Lalita’s husband abandoned her in 2015 and married another woman.
